Output 25e65d100a95e9c7231b6915bfad7468e04ab510e0545737f42894de5496d2c9: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757bd8019cd6af858c532d72d0d420341fbea734 OP_EQUAL
address
3CQDLobfe2atMeFc5zGxR5MfEv36Tj5M9F
transaction
25e65d100a95e9c7231b6915bfad7468e04ab510e0545737f42894de5496d2c9
confirmations
137187
spent
true